The Foundation of Modern Development

The steel industry has laid the groundwork for modern cities and technologies. From towering skyscrapers to domestic appliances, its applications are boundless. Steel’s inherent properties, such as strength and malleability, make it indispensable in construction and manufacturing.

Sustainability and Environmental Impact

The push towards sustainability has not left the steel industry behind. Significant strides have been made to minimize environmental impact. Recycling has become a critical component, as described in this guide by ArcelorMittal, showcasing how steel can be continually repurposed without losing its strength.

Economic Backbone

Steel production is a major economic driver, providing millions of jobs worldwide. It is an essential export product, contributing to economic stability across various countries.
